Hollywood Oscar‑season parties and charity events with celebrity attendees The document is a social‑scene narrative describing parties, charity dinners, and informal conversations among entertainment figures. It contains no concrete allegations, financial transactions, or links to political or intelligence actors that would merit investigative follow‑up. The only potentially actionable detail is a mention of a $320,000 donation to the ACLU and International Rescue Committee, but the source and recipients are already public. Overall the passage offers minimal investigative value and low controversy. Key insights: Mentions a $320,000 fundraiser for the ACLU and International Rescue Committee at a UTA event.; References President Trump's travel ban and Asghar Farhadi's protest, but only in a passing comment.; Lists numerous celebrity attendees at various Oscar‑season gatherings.
